Red Orchid Cactus, epiphyllum
Prices start at : 14.99 USD

Hybrid Orchid Cactus typically open at night but often last well through the next day. Epiphyllums are one of the few true jungle Cacti where they are often found growing with the orchids and bromeliads far removed from the forest floor.

Korean Spice Viburnum
Prices start at : 12.99 USD

Clusters of dark pink to red buds open to highly fragrant white flowers in mid and late spring. The flowers are followed by 1/4" red fruit that ripens to black. Fall foliage often becomes a brilliant red.

Fragrant Olive, Sweet Osmanthus Osmanthus fragrans
Prices start at : 6.95 USD / 1 packet

Sweet osmanthus is also the 'city flower' of Hangzhou , China. They are also added to herbal medicines in order to disguise obnoxious flavours. * The unripe fruits are preserved in brine like olives.

Flowering Tobacco, Jasmine Tobacco Nicotiana alata
Prices start at : 1.95 USD / 1 packet

It is called Winged Tobacco , Jasmine Tobacco , tanbaku , and sometimes Persian Tobacco , though the latter name is also used for Nicotiana persica . * All parts of the plant contain nicotine, this has been extracted and used as an insecticide.
